Lately, I have been playing a bit of darkest hour, and although I enjoy the game, the fact that I can exploit the trade mechanism ruins the fun. I could just not use "gamey" features, but I want to be able to play at my best without being able to use it at my advantage.
So, how the trade is rigged in hoi2, is that a player can trade all their blueprints for money and supplies. Whenever I invent a new technology, I slow down the speed and go through all the countries and sell my blueprint to each country. It takes some time to go through every 100~ countries, but basically I end up making over 1000 € for each technology I discover.
Also, I can exploit the fact that countries give different value to different resources. I can easily make as many resources as I like by just trading undervalued resources to overvalued resources between the countries.
All this trading takes a lot of time so my darkest hour experience is basically to click on "open negotiations" Windows for hours and hours.
